Latex Gloves: The Flexible Classic

Latex gloves have been a staple in healthcare and research for decades. Made from natural rubber, they are super stretchy, biodegradable, and fit like a second skin—giving wearers excellent dexterity and touch sensitivity. But there’s a catch! Latex allergies are a real issue, making them off-limits for some users.

Best For: Medical exams, surgeries, and delicate lab work.
Not Ideal If: You or your patients have latex allergies.

Nitrile Gloves: The Tough Protector

Meet nitrile gloves—the superhero of chemical and puncture resistance! These gloves are made from synthetic rubber, meaning no allergies, no problem. Nitrile is stronger than latex and offers excellent resistance to chemicals, oils, and punctures. If you’re dealing with hazardous materials, this is your go-to glove!

Best For: Medical professionals, lab researchers, mechanics, and tattoo artists.
Not Ideal If: You need extreme tactile sensitivity (nitrile is slightly thicker than latex).

Vinyl Gloves: The Budget-Friendly Choice

Vinyl gloves are the most affordable option, but that comes with trade-offs. Made from PVC (polyvinyl chloride), they are loose-fitting and less durable. While they work well for low-risk tasks, they aren’t the best for handling chemicals or sharp objects.

Best For: Food handling, cleaning, and basic hygiene tasks.
Not Ideal If: You need strong durability or protection from hazardous materials.

Which Glove Should You Choose?

Feature Latex Nitrile Vinyl
Allergy Risk High None None
Dexterity Excellent Good Fair
Durability Moderate High Low
Chemical Resistance Low High Low
Cost Moderate Higher Low
